The Bible offers profound guidance on cultivating strong and loving families, emphasizing principles of respect, commitment, and selfless love. From the foundational command to honor parents to the encouragement of patience and kindness within the household, these verses paint a picture of family as a sacred unit built on faith and mutual support. Passages highlighting the husband-wife relationship underscore the importance of fidelity and partnership, while those concerning children emphasize their value and the responsibility of parents to nurture their spiritual and emotional growth.
